Challenges Faced in Primary School Chinese

As students embark on their educational journey in Singapore, one of the pivotal subjects they encounter is Chinese. The complexity of the language, coupled with the demands of a rigorous school curriculum, presents a unique set of challenges that students must navigate. In this section, we will explore the common problems faced by students when studying Primary School Chinese and shed light on how the intense school curriculum and limited exposure to the language can impact their Mandarin studies.

The Academic Load Dilemma

1. Vigorous School Curriculum:

  • The primary school curriculum in Singapore is known for its intensity, focusing on a wide range of subjects, including English, Math, and Science.
  • Students often find themselves juggling multiple subjects, leaving them with limited time to dedicate to Chinese studies.

2. Impact of Co-Curricular Activities (CCA):

  • Co-Curricular Activities are an integral part of the education system in Singapore.
  • These activities demand students’ time and energy, further reducing the time they can allocate to mastering the Chinese language.

The Challenge of Limited Exposure

1. Learning Mandarin as a Second Language:

  • For many students, Chinese is not their mother tongue.
  • Learning Mandarin as a second language can be akin to acquiring a foreign language, which can be particularly challenging.

2. Insufficient Exposure:

  • In school, students typically have hour-long Chinese lessons two to three times a week.
  • This limited exposure is often insufficient for students to develop proficiency in the language.

The Last-Minute Approach

1. Lack of Interest:

  • Students who have weak foundations and a lack of interest in the Chinese language may postpone studying until the day before their exams.
  • This cramming approach does not promote long-term retention or proficiency.

2. Compromised Performance:

  • The last-minute approach often results in compromised performance in Chinese exams, which can affect overall academic performance.

These challenges can be overwhelming for both students and parents. The limited exposure to the language and the academic load placed on students can make mastering Chinese a formidable task.
